
There are 42 Companies in Germany
that provide Go development Services!
Germany is home to the single largest IT market in Europe, accounting for around a quarter of the European market by value. Increased business demand for smart data products and services in the cloud is driving domestic IT market growth, as Germany embarks on a far-reaching program of digitalization that promises to transform the economy.
Discover Top IT Companies in Germany specialized in Go and other related services. Find the best IT service providers for your projects.
Go, also known as Golang, is an open-source programming language created by Google. It is designed for simplicity, efficiency, and concurrency, making it a versatile choice for building a wide range of applications, from web services to system software.
Handpicked companies • No obligation to hire • 100% risk-free
Featured Companies in Germany
This month, the following Go development companies managed to provide an outstanding service and support. It's worth taking a look.
Edvantis is a mature, value-oriented software development partner with the HQ in Berlin, Germany, and the development centers in Eastern Europe.
Explore Top Go development Companies in Germany
Fire Bee Techno Services is an ISO Certified Blockchain and AI Development Company In india and across the world with 13+ years of experience.
UX design studio that builds precise, intuitive interfaces for complex systems—where usability meets high-stakes innovation.
Services:
Microsoft GOLD Certified Partner | Scrum Master Certified | Magento 2 Certified | 2000+ Projects | 300+ Team | 500+ Global Clients | 50+ Technologies
Custom websites & web apps, clean UI/UX, and AI-powered tools - delivered on time with transparent communication to grow your business.
Services:
Digital transformation partner: GDPR-compliant AI & cloud solutions with customizable AI Agents. We develop innovative AI products, like voice agents.

Notch Software Solutions Verified Company
Frankfurt am Main, Germany Head office in: Croatia
Custom Digital Products development and consulting. Translating your business requirements and needs into enterprise-grade software solutions.
Kulimo bietet professionelles, individuelles Webdesign, Webentwicklung und Business App-Entwicklung in Berlin.

Köln (Cologne), Germany Head office in: Pakistan
Techelix is a software agency that helps you with solutions, serving your business needs, by channeling disruptive ideas into actionable strategies

Persistent Systems Verified Company
Frankfurt am Main, Germany Head office in: India
See Beyond, Rise Above
Services:
- 1
- 2
Filter Go development Companies in Germany by Cities
Dive deeper and find the company you need close to you or, from a specific city you prefer. Some of the best companies come from smaller places
Find more Go development companies around the world
TechBehemoths is the world's most advanced and user-friendly platform to match IT Companies with real clients without hustle.
The German ICT Industry: Data, Companies and Predictions
Germany is home to the single largest IT market in Europe, accounting for around a quarter of the European market by value. Innovation comes as standard in an industry characterized by a thriving of small and medium-sized enterprises. Increased business demand for smart data products and services in the cloud is driving domestic IT market growth, as Germany embarks on a far-reaching program of digitalization that promises to transform the economy.
According to Payscale, the average salary of a web developer in Germany is estimated at around 3,500 EUR/mo - one of the highest in Europe, which defines the high demand on the market for digital services and products, but it also reveals the high-quality services companies based in Germany provide. According to Statista, the IT industry market in Germany is predicted to reach $75.48 billion by 2025, with IT Outsourcing dominating this market, reaching $32.15 billion. It has a CAGR for 2025-2030 of 3.33%, expecting a market volume of $88.94 billion by 2030. Germany is a leader in IT services, prioritizing innovation, and delivers high quality services.
Why Should You Work With German IT Companies?
Needless to say that the presence of tech giants in Germany, and their continuous investment in the local IT environment, is one of the basic indicators of a healthy IT industry. But, most importantly, the fundamentals of the IT industry in Germany are small and medium businesses that face tough competition, which in turn stimulates the growth and development of the entire IT ecosystem. Based on a report from the International Trade Administration, in 2025, the number of IT companies in Germany was above 100K, and Berlin only the most developed digital hub, was the home of 38K+ IT companies.
However, the main reasons for working with German IT companies remain a good business culture, rich experience, and skilled professionals.
What You Should Be Aware of When Working With a German IT Company
Despite the benefits of working with German companies, there are several factors that you should be aware of. First of all, the huge number of companies creates difficulties when choosing only one. It is possible to experience psychological fatigue due to the wide variety of good offers you may receive from German or German-based agencies. Despite these challenges, hiring a IT service provider from Germany can bring lower costs than other people expect, talented tech professionals, good education system, stable business ecosystem, productive tech experts, and attention to details.
Speaking of the differences between German and German-based IT companies, this is another challenge to make the difference in which type of company you contacted. There is a performance difference between the two types of companies mentioned above, but not always in favor of the first one.
Are German Companies Reliable?
German IT companies have probably the best reputation in Europe, especially due to the high number of projects they attract, but also based on the country’s business reputation in general. Even though more foreign companies from countries with questionable reputations relocated or declared themselves as German, the overall rating didn’t go down, but on the contrary. This may be explained by the fact that foreign companies would rather adapt to German rules and improve their reputation as well.
How the German IT Industry Relates to the Neighboring Countries
Having ¼ of the European market value, the German IT industry is considered to be the most developed, with the UK and France in second and third position, far behind it. In 2025, Germany holds approximately 19.7% of the market share, followed by the UK at 16.2% and France at 12%. Both countries have robust tech environments that dominates the European continent, with Germany that leads in high-tech industries, and the UK as a prominent tech economy.
What is Go and what are its benefits for your projects?
Go, also known as Golang, is an open-source programming language created by Google. It is designed for simplicity, efficiency, and concurrency, making it a versatile choice for building a wide range of applications, from web services to system software.
More than 363 verified IT companies leverage Go in their development projects. These companies range from startups to tech giants like Google, Uber, and Dropbox. They appreciate Go's speed, reliability, and ease of use for building scalable and performant software.
Go service providers rely on various tools and technologies to enhance their development process. Some commonly used tools include the Go compiler, which transforms Go code into executable binaries, and the Go standard library, which offers essential packages for building applications. In terms of deployment, containerization technologies like Docker are frequently used to package Go applications for consistency and portability.
You may be wondering, how is Go Different from C, Rust, and Java. So, below we’ll try to show you more about the differences that exist between them:
-
Go vs. C: While both Go and C are low-level languages, Go offers modern features like garbage collection and memory safety, which simplify programming. Go is also more concise and expressive than C, making it easier to read and maintain. But if you think your business needs companies that also specialize in C, you can find them on this page
-
Go vs. Rust: Rust emphasizes memory safety and control without sacrificing performance. While Go offers simplicity and readability, Rust provides fine-grained control over memory and is suitable for systems programming with a focus on safety.
-
Go vs. Java: Java is a high-level language often used for building enterprise-level applications. It relies on a virtual machine (JVM) and is known for platform independence. Go, on the other hand, compiles native code, offering better performance and efficiency for certain use cases.
Languages related to Go in terms of use cases and features include Python, Ruby, and Node.js. These languages, like Go, are suitable for building web services and backend applications and are known for their developer-friendly features. If you need these programming languages in addition or instead of Go, just click on their corresponding words above to find verified vendors providing those services.
When selecting IT companies that use Go for your project, consider factors such as the company's experience with Go, their portfolio of past projects, client references, and their understanding of your specific project requirements. Look for companies that align with your project's complexity, scalability needs, and budget.
Go service providers are essential for various project types, including:
-
Web Services: Go is well-suited for building RESTful APIs and microservices due to its excellent performance and simplicity.
-
Networking Applications: Go's concurrency support makes it ideal for developing network-related software such as servers and proxies.
-
Cloud Applications: Go's efficiency and speed are valuable for building cloud-native applications and serverless functions.
-
System Software: Go can be used for developing system utilities, command-line tools, and operating system components.
Go is a versatile language, and its speed, simplicity, and efficient concurrency model make it suitable for a wide range of projects, making it an excellent choice for modern software development.